Selenium(Python)创建Chrome浏览器实例

1. 下载Chrome浏览器驱动

最新版的Selenium内置了selenium manager 工具,运行Selenium程序时,它可以帮我们自动下载浏览器驱动。Edge、FireFox直接创建实例即可,但是自动下载Chrome浏览器驱动时却错误不断,因此需要手动下载配置。

国内下载镜像:

https://registry.npmmirror.com/binary.html?path=chrome-for-testing/

查看Chrome浏览器版本

选择对应的版本下载

2. 创建Chrome浏览器实例

解压,复制驱动路径

创建实例

python 复制代码
# 导包
from selenium.webdriver.chrome.service import Service
# 创建Chrome浏览器实例
wd = webdriver.Chrome(service=Service(r"c:\tools\chromedriver-win64\chromedriver.exe"))
相关推荐
中文Python2 小时前
小白中文Python-db_桌面小黄鸭宠物
数据库·python·pygame·宠物·中文python·小白学python
MoRanzhi12034 小时前
12. Pandas 数据合并与拼接(concat 与 merge)
数据库·人工智能·python·数学建模·矩阵·数据分析·pandas
qianmo20214 小时前
基于gitpage实现网页托管的方式方法
python
松果集4 小时前
【1】数据类型1
python
蔗理苦4 小时前
2025-10-07 Python不基础 19——私有对象
开发语言·python·私有对象
可触的未来,发芽的智生5 小时前
触摸未来2025.10.04:当神经网络拥有了内在记忆……
人工智能·python·神经网络·算法·架构
蔗理苦6 小时前
2025-10-07 Python不基础 20——全局变量与自由变量
开发语言·python
xiaohanbao096 小时前
理解神经网络流程
python·神经网络
韩立学长6 小时前
【开题答辩实录分享】以《基于Python的旅游网站数据爬虫研究》为例进行答辩实录分享
python·旅游